First, find the instructions:thumbsup: If it is anything like the US Steel building, make sure the foundation is level and square. Mine fits into a channel that keeps the bottom in place. Put the sections together on the ground if you can lift the whole section. If not, it is possible to put half up at a time. Scaffolding, on wheels is big help. put the bolts in loose, tighten after the building is complete. Mine is 25x40, 13 ft high, and I had no problems, just 1 or2 guys helping part of the time. I actually put the first two bows up by my self, no power equipment. Wouldn't do that part again, but it is possible if the wind is not blowing.
